Title: AWS Cloud Developer

Location: Hybrid on site in Washington, DC

Duration: 6 months contract to hire

Pay rate on contract: $50 - $60 per hour contingent upon experience

Salary upon conversion: $100,000 - $130,000 annually

Job Description:

  • Serve as a member of an Agile team to provide engineering support and maintenance of services and processes that migrate and promote data and algorithms to the AWS cloud environment and supporting cloud databases.
  • Design, code, test and implement AWS cloud-based solutions
  • Work with the customer and team on requirements gathering and task estimation.
  • Perform routine data checks, code development and quality checks.
  • Support database planning, design and implementation
  • Support systems analysis, design and implementation
  • Support code reviews and cloud deployments
  • Provide regular status updates on progress both within the Agile framework and via weekly status reporting.


Required q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in computer science and 5 years of experience or a High School Diploma or equivalent and 9 years of experience
  • Familiar with tools such as AWS API Gateway, Lambda, S3, Git, Jenkins, EC2, Step Function, Hive, Glue Catalog, Spectrum, Athena, S3, SNS SQS
  • Experience with Python, XML
  • Strong experience in analyzing and designing data migration strategies to load data from on-perm data warehouse to cloud data warehouse (Redshift and RDS).
  • Experience in ETL process using AWS resources
  • Industry XML data exchange message formats, required modifications, or extensions
  • Experience/knowledge of XML, FIXML, or FPML is a plus
  • AWS developer certified
